Hello all. I'm trying to find some info on a pendant I came across recently. I am mainly concerned with the time period it might have been made and probable country of origin. It has no makers marks that I can find, but it is marked "Sterling". It looks like it was cast, but made to look like repose. At the bottom on the front there was apparently a crack in the mold, and there is some extra material on the back near the point of the heart. Any information or ideas would be appreciated.

it appears to be a recasting of a Reed & Barton Christmas ornament. the originals were die-struck with a flat backing (hollow inside).
